Allah's Intervention: Ibrahim and the Fire
In this exploration, we delve into the remarkable narrative of Ibrahim (Abraham) and the divine intervention when he was cast into the fire. This story, deeply embedded in Islamic tradition, illuminates profound lessons of faith, trust, and divine protection.
1. Ibrahim's Dilemma
Ibrahim, a revered prophet in Islam, faced immense persecution for his belief in the Oneness of God. His adversaries, unable to sway him, resorted to the extreme measure of casting him into a blazing fire.
2. Trust in Allah's Will
Despite the seemingly dire situation, Ibrahim maintained unwavering trust in Allah's plan. His faith exemplifies the essence of submission to the divine will, regardless of outward circumstances.
3. Allah's Command
In this critical moment, Allah, in His infinite mercy and power, intervened. He commanded the fire: "O fire, be coolness and safety upon Ibrahim" (Quran 21:69). This divine decree defied the natural order, transforming the fire into a source of coolness and safety for Ibrahim.
4. Miraculous Protection
Through Allah's intervention, the fire, intended for destruction, became a means of miraculous protection for Ibrahim. This supernatural occurrence serves as a profound testament to the power of divine intervention and the ultimate safeguarding of the righteous.
